Transaction 285559237d1b802ba91d656d6c8dedccbb7f4edb2e10b5ee3227e0df2754aa66
1 Input
1 Output
-
285559237d1b802ba91d656d6c8dedccbb7f4edb2e10b5ee3227e0df2754aa66:0
- value
- 103892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f3f519a41fd9bc2d7838badba2e245bc4aca96a OP_EQUAL
- address
- 335dutL2zSzb497HcUYeytau6KCEuU1E2v